Apple CEO Steve Jobs apologizes for iPhone price cut (CNN.com)
SAN JOSE, California (AP) — Apple CEO Steve Jobs apologized and offered $100 credits Thursday to people who shelled out up to $599 for an iPhone this summer and were burned when the company chopped $200 from the expensive model’s price.
Early iPhone buyers to get $100 credit (USA Today)
Apple is offering early iPhone buyers $100 in store credit in an attempt to squelch the backlash against a dramatic price drop.
IPhone Owners Crying Foul Over Price Cut (New York Times)
On Thursday, Apple C.E.O. Steven P. Jobs acknowledged that the company had abused its core customers? trust and extended a $100 store credit to the early iPhone buyers.
